Subject: [PATCH] Bluetooth: A2MP: Do not set rsp.id to zero

Due to security reasons the rsp struct is not zerod out in one case this will
also zero out the former set rsp.id which seems to be wrong.

Signed-off-by: Stefan Gottwald <gotti79@...teo.net>
---
 net/bluetooth/a2mp.c | 3 ++-
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/net/bluetooth/a2mp.c b/net/bluetooth/a2mp.c
index da7fd7c..7a1e0b7 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/a2mp.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/a2mp.c
@@ -381,10 +381,11 @@ static int a2mp_getampassoc_req(struct amp_mgr *mgr, struct sk_buff *skb,
 	hdev = hci_dev_get(req->id);
 	if (!hdev || hdev->amp_type == AMP_TYPE_BREDR || tmp) {
 		struct a2mp_amp_assoc_rsp rsp;
-		rsp.id = req->id;
 
 		memset(&rsp, 0, sizeof(rsp));
 
+		rsp.id = req->id;
+
 		if (tmp) {
 			rsp.status = A2MP_STATUS_COLLISION_OCCURED;
 			amp_mgr_put(tmp);
